Frank L. McLaughlin, 87, of New Eagle, died unexpectedly, Thursday, Sept. 29, 2022. He was born Feb. 16, 1935, in New Eagle, the son of Blaine G. and Dorothy Lonkoski McLaughlin. Frank was a member of First Christian Church in Monongahela. He retired from the former Hercules (Ireco) Inc. in Donora, with over 30 years of employment. After retirement, Frank and his wife, Peggy, spent 21 years as snowbirds traveling to Florida. He loved boating, fishing, and being on the river in both Florida and Pennsylvania. He enjoyed participating in rodeos in South Park and Western Pennsylvania, especially bull riding, bareback riding and Conestoga wagon racing. He was also a huge collector of Wile E. Coyote memorabilia. Frank was a family-oriented man and will be truly missed by all. He is survived by his wife, Peggy A. McLaughlin, with whom he celebrated 68 years of marriage on March 15, 2022; daughter, Debbie Axton of Monongahela; son, Frank McLaughlin Jr. of New Castle; four grandchildren, Brandi Axton, Lauri Mosley, Frank R. (Pam) McLaughlin and Brooke (Brian) McLaughlin; three great-grandchildren, Brody and Laney Susick and Hayden Scheidemantle; and a sister-in-law, Donna McLaughlin of Charleroi. In addition to his parents, he was preceded in death by his son-in-law, Larry Axton; and brother, Blaine McLaughlin.
